Well, let's get to the point. I have a form where I have an INPUT tag that is like this: <INPUT TYPE="TEXT" NAME="cant" SIZE="3" MAXLENGTH="3">
It is used to input a number... But in the DTML file used to process the form, I want to use a range where the max is the "cant" inputed at the INPUT tag... I have a <!--#in cant-->, but obviously Zope complains that strings cannot be used in 'in' tags... So, how do I do to iterate in asequence that starts on 1 and ends on 'cant'? On python I would create a list but I don't know how to do this using only DTML methods. Is it possible?
In python you'd use the range() method, but that method is not available in Zope, at least, not in version 1.x. Zope 2 does include a range method, it's a member of the _ object. You would use it like this: <!--#in "_.range(1, cant)"--> In Zope 1.x, you'll have to create an external method that returns the result of the python range method for you: def MyRange(iMax): return range(1, iMax) and call it from your in tag: <!--#in "MyRange(iMax=cant)"--> Note: Above code is untested.
